Actually, Vanity Fair has traditionally had very good (and often juicy) coverage of business related scandals and other stories. Clearly they're limited to the monthly publication cycle, but their strength in covering some of these stories in a long-form non-fiction narrative is one of the things that got me so excited about the launch of Portfolio. With a few exceptions (notably the website) Portfolio has been something of a let-down; I continue to think that most of the VF finance/business related stories are superior.
